What is Mesothelioma?
Mesothelioma is a deadly tumor that develops in the mesothelium, the thin layer of tissue that covers much of the internal organs. Early diagnosis is essential for improving treatment outcomes. The diagnostic process generally includes numerous steps:

Medical History and Physical Exam: Doctors will examine the patient's case history and perform a health examination.

Imaging Tests: X-rays, CT scans, and MRIs help determine irregularities in the lungs, abdomen, or chest.

Biopsy: A definitive diagnosis is made through a biopsy, where a tissue sample is taken and examined for cancer cells.

Laboratory Tests: Blood tests may likewise be carried out to identify specific markers associated with mesothelioma.
Staging Mesothelioma
When diagnosed, the cancer is staged to figure out how far it has actually progressed. The phases vary from one (localized) to 4 (metastatic). Comprehending the phase assists in preparing treatment choices.
